There was a full writeup about it with pix on RV.net, but it looks like they lost it and all my posts there.


Basically a 1" steel tubing welded up frame bolted to the floor with 3/4" lightweight plywood deck. Totally clear underneath from wheelwell to wheelwell and up the bolster boxes. Probably about 5X5 feet clear with passthrough to aisle and hinged deck for access to storage from inside the van. 5" marine latex mattress custom made to fit the area.


We have had it for probably 10 years and would never go back to the power sofa with no storage under it.
